The Federal Financial Institutions Examination Council (FFIEC) recognizes the importance of protecting sensitive information. It states that “Financial institutions should deploy encryption to mitigate the risk of disclosure or alteration of sensitive information in storage and transit.” (FFIEC Information Security Handbook, December 2002), and that “Management should consider using encryption technology to secure data transmission.” (FFIEC Operations Handbook, June 2004) What you do to protect the confidentiality and integrity of information assets, and monitoring for and detecting unauthorized access to the information is a federal mandate. (GLBA, Sarbanes-Oxley Act, FACTA, USA Patriot Act)

In the “good old days”, financial service providers used the postal service to communicate with customers. Other communications between employees and customers took place over the telephone or in person. A bank, for example, would use its customer records to address and envelope and then stamp and seal it. Once mailed, the bank placed its trust in the delivery mechanisms to maintain the confidentiality of the information sent. Along with these traditional communication mechanisms, the bank also generally trusted employees to keep all non-public information private.

Fast forward to today…. when modern financial service providers use a variety of communication channels to obtain, use, and transmit customer information, and to collaborate with customers, employees, and business partners. Although many still use “traditional” means, banks now use electronic communications such as Email and transactional websites. Bank employees use the same means to communicate with each other and to perform their daily duties which includes sharing non-public and sensitive customer information.

Now more than ever, financial service providers’ reputations are at risk if they are not able to assure customers that they can keep their information safe and secure, and that they have effective physical, administrative, and technical safeguards in place to monitor and control any unauthorized attempts to access that information. In a business where maintaining the customer’s trust is vital, tools and controls that ensure security of sensitive information are essential. ZixPort comes in two flavors – COMPOSE, and NON-COMPOSE. When an encrypted Email is delivered via ZixPort, the user receives a notification email that links to the secure message portal. After logging in, the user can view their message and any attachments over a secure SSL connection.

securEMAIL ZixPort is branded to match the look and feel of your corporate website and configured to meet your communications needs. It lets anyone securely read and reply to encrypted emails you send. With the COMPOSE option you can setup two-way communications with customers, board members, business partners, and others. With the COMPOSE option, your customers can initiate an encrypted Email conversation with you via your website. You can add a “Contact Us” button on your site that allows them to securely contact you even if they don’t have email encryption capabilities themselves.
